Originally Posted by 92_964
Just did the engine cover struts...15 min right side, 25 left (removed the blower). This little tool helped by inserting into the pin clamps and twisting slightly to expand the clamps (on the forward ones...the others are easy enough to reach). It also made replacing the front trunk struts much simpler a few months ago by inserting and twisting slightly to loosen the retaining ring on the bottom end.

Craftsman Professional Screwdriver 1\8 in. X 10 in. Model# 47164
Its only been 9 years(!), but thanks for this suggestion. I previously tried and failed to get the lower connection of the hood shocks off, but with this screw driver, success. The dental floss tip upthread to secure the upper clip also was used to great effect. :-)
